Celtic extend their lead on top

 

Celtic beat Rangers 3-0 in a Scottish Premier League encounter at the Celtic Park on Sunday. A brace from Gary Hooper and goal by Kris Commons helped the Bhoys cruise past their local rivals in the Old firm. The win takes Celtic eight points clear at the
top of the table.

Neil Lennon made only one change to his starting line-up that beat Dundee United 3-1 last weekend. Anthony Stokes was replaced by Georgios Samaras upfront in a 4-4-2 formation. Walter Smith also made one change to his side that thrashed Motherwell 6-0 last
weekend. Maurice Edu replaced Vladimir Weiss in a 4-5-1 formation.

The game started briskly as both teams looked to make early inroads. A late tackle from Kyle Bartley on Scott Brown earned him the first booking of the match in the 3rd minute. The first chance of the game fell for Celtic, when Hooper made a brilliantly
run into the box and his shot flew just wide of the far post. The hosts were rewarded for their beautiful attacking play when they opened the scoring in the 17th minute. Commons made a surging run from the left and squared the ball to Hooper, who
knocked it past the static defence and into the far corner to make it 1-0 for the hosts. The visitor’s first real chance of the game arrived in the 21st minute, when El Hadji Diouf smashed a shot from close range, way above the bar.  The Bhoys doubled
their lead in the 28th minute, Emilio Izaguirre motored down the left and squared a low ball across the box and Hooper slided it into the far post to make it 2-0 for the hosts. The game dried up after the goal and the visitors were shocked as Celtic
went into the half time break 2-0 up.

The visitors started the second half in a much positive manner as they came close of scoring immediately after the resumption. The hosts created a flurry of chances and were rewarded for their third goal in the 70th minute. Commons turned past
Madjid Bougherra and fired in a swerving strike that deceived Allan McGregor and flied past him into the net. The visitors were down and out and Celtic went on to win 3-0 at fulltime.

Celtic play their next match against Motherwell on 27th February, while Rangers play against St.Johnstone on the same day.
